Precisely what is a "packaged boiler"?

The phrase "Packaged Boiler" is employed to describe a boiler that's factory built and shipped possibly thoroughly assembled or, as pre-created modules which can be simply assembled on web site. It is essentially a self contained unit complete which has a Regulate process and all products essential for operation. The boiler manufacturer assumes responsibility for all factors and immediately after shipping all of that is required is for it to be linked to the steam distribution process, drinking water, fuel, and electricity materials. Just about all modest and medium sized boilers produced these days are packaged boilers and they may be the standard firetube or watertube form, like their derivatives or, hybrid boilers including once-as a result of coil and electrode boilers.

Precisely what is an unattended boiler?

An Unattended Boiler is actually a totally automatic boiler that operates underneath the continuous supervision and control of a classy, micro-processor based, BCS. The BCS controls your entire boiler functionality including the Strength enter management technique (on oil and fuel-fired boilers generally generally known as the "Burner Administration Method" or, BMS), the drinking water amount management technique, the alarm procedure, the stress controls, excursion equipment, all instruments and circuitry.

A crucial element of this type of boiler is in the majority of jurisdictions boiler codes and standards dictate that a boiler that is classified as unattended have to be less than the continuous supervision and control of the BCS always that it's in services. The unattended boiler could only be operated in unattended manner. It is probably not operated in attended mode beneath any situation even for temporary periods and also if a certified operator is out there. In practice, the BCS utilized on an unattended boiler has no provision for guide Procedure. In the occasion of a Management procedure fault or a possibly unsafe issue, the BCS will shut down the boiler and lock-out the Electricity enter system. It'll avert a boiler restart until eventually these types of time that the Manage program fault has become fixed or, the doubtless unsafe condition continues to be tackled and each of the BCS inputs point out which the boiler is in a secure ailment.

The BCS is equipped with some indicates of recording all main functions that bring about the alarms to activate. On early unattended boilers this was commonly a straightforward printer that recorded such events on a line-by-line basis. A lot more modern day programs on the other hand, retail outlet the data during the onboard micro-processor memory for an prolonged interval. They typically record a A lot wider variety of information to supply improved oversight of boiler efficiency and, are sometimes integrated using a plant-vast details technique which facilitates the remote storage of information for extended intervals.

Limited-Attendance vs here Unattended Procedure

To realize Restricted-Attendance or Unattended classification, the boiler is subject to rigorous statutory oversight covering operation, routine maintenance, servicing and file maintaining. Boiler codes and standards have to have that boilers in both category be Geared up by using a minimal, specified stock of basic safety gear that should mechanically shut down the boiler inside the event of the probably unsafe condition.

The classification placed on a specific packaged boiler will count mostly around the sophistication of your BCS or, often, the type of gasoline which is fired. For example, a ten MW boiler firing organic fuel may possibly attain unattended classification where by an identical 10 MW boiler through the exact same company but firing sound-fuel could possibly be classified as confined-attendance. Firing sound-fuels, particularly People having a variable humidity material, is typically one thing of the black-art demanding a degree of talent and knowledge. In this writer's jurisdiction, unattended solid-gasoline boilers are nevertheless not unheard of even for fairly substantial boilers more than twenty MW capability and infrequently in numerous boiler installations.

The real key distinctions concerning the Restricted-Attendance and Unattended modes of Procedure are:

Restricted Attendance

• An correctly certified operator or dependable individual need to be on-website always that the boiler is in provider;

• Codes and standards normally require the boiler be consistently supervised throughout startup and shutdown durations;

• Throughout standard Procedure, the restricted-attendance manner allows for periodic examining of your boiler at set minimum amount intervals as opposed to ongoing supervision;

• Constrained-Attendance boilers may perhaps Anytime be introduced beneath the Charge of an appropriately experienced operator and operated during the absolutely attended manner less than steady supervision;

• The operator or liable man or woman must be on-internet site all of the time that the boiler is in services and need to be immediately available if required.

Unattended

• In which unattended Procedure is permitted, a professional operator is not a mandatory prerequisite. The boiler may very well be supervised by an properly trained "Dependable Particular person";

• The operator or responsible human being may perhaps go away the location offered that they is out there to respond to boiler outages. That is normally realized by a pager or cellphone sign transmitted from the BCS;

• In lots of jurisdictions, unattended boilers may well initiate and shut down automatically beneath the Charge of the BCS furnished that they're suitably equipped for the pleasure of the authorised inspection body;

• Unattended boilers are allowed to function unsupervised for prolonged durations and for most jurisdictions this is at present 24-hrs. New Command and monitoring methods innovations by some makers on the other hand, have found that period extended in some jurisdictions. The 72H notation in Europe as an example, signifies the boiler is permitted for unsupervised Procedure for durations of up to 72-hours;

• Boiler codes in many jurisdictions especially forbid the provision for guide intervention while in the Procedure of unattended boilers. They have to all of the time be under the control of the BCS. That is, they may only be operated in unattended mode. They might not be operated in attended method beneath any conditions even for transient intervals and in many cases if an experienced operator is out there.

Who is the boiler controller? - roles and obligations:

Boiler codes and standards normally require that unattended boiler installations Have a very nominated "Controller". This can be the owner or, somebody nominated by the proprietor to accomplish that part. The Controller would not necessarily should be intently involved with palms-on, day-to-day Procedure but rather, to offer typical oversight in the boiler Procedure and maintenance.

The Controller's duties include things like:

• Ensuring compliance Together with the Boiler code or applicable regular which include the upkeep of proper operational and engineering data;

• Making sure that the boiler is supervised by properly capable or educated people;

• The implementation and routine maintenance of a high quality Administration Process (QMS);

• The implementation and maintenance of proper basic safety and environmental procedures and, communications with the appropriate regulatory bodies by way of example, OSHA, environmental organizations, inspection bodies and so on.

The Controller is usually a engineering, servicing or departmental supervisor or, somebody inside the Group that retains a qualification or Certificate of Competency in boiler operation.

precisely what is a properly trained responsible particular person? - roles and obligations:

A "Properly trained Responsible Individual" is somebody that is appointed because of the controller to exercise day-to-day supervision on the boiler. He / she is not required to maintain a formal qualification like a certification of competency but, must be educated to some stage specified because of the boiler company or, to a level satisfactory by an inspection human body or other ideal regulatory authority. The Liable Person isn't required to have an intimate familiarity with boiler know-how but alternatively, a basic level of knowledge and an knowledge of the performance and roles on the boiler parts, mountings and ancillary devices such as the gasoline, feedwater, and steam distribution systems.

The primary roles from the Accountable Individual are to workout standard working day-to-working day supervision with the boiler Procedure, validate that every one Command and alarm units are performing correctly and to ensure compliance Using the schedule testing processes specified in the pertinent code or normal and, through the boiler producer. The Accountable Particular person shouldn't always be anticipated to diagnose and rectify tools or program failure. They need to be capable to answer alarms, and to consider suitable action which, at a minimum, ensures that the boiler is shut down safely before contacting for aid.
